Verizon Wireless Samsung Reality to release on April 22

Samsung Reality

Samsung users will soon awaken to a new ‘Reality’. Verizon Wireless and Samsung are all set to launch the new phone, Samsung Reality. The phone is sleek and trendy, to be made available in two colors, Piano Black and City Red.

The phone sports a three-inch WQVGA touchscreen display, a slide out QWERTY keyboard, personalizable widgets and various messaging options. Users can send across messages in the form of texts, pictures, videos or voice messages. Also, there is Mobile IM, Mobile Chat, Mobile Email and Mobile Web Email. With the 3.2 MP camera, users can click pictures or shoot videos in the dark with ease via the night shot mode. The phone also gives users options to shoot in single, multiple, panorama, mosaic and frame shot modes.

Samsung Reality possesses interesting photo editing features like the Dynamic Canvas, which supports flash animation in pictures. Apart from this, Bluetooth technology for headset, hands-free and Dial-Up Networking is accessible. Basic functions like phonebook access, basic print, imaging, object push for vCard and vCalendar, File transfer and serial port have been included as well. Users caught up with work all the time can make use of the corporate Email support to view Microsoft Office Exchange and sync their corporate emails, contacts and calendar from their office with their phone.

Apart from business concerns, the Samsung Reality also allows access to social networking services. With the VZ Navigator, users can receive voice-enabled directions to more than 15 million interesting points and share them with others. There is also the Visual Voice Mail that makes deleting, replying or forwarding voice messages without having to listen to them over and over again. With the media centre, users can conveniently download games, wallpapers and other graphics for their phone. Other functions include a personal organizer with tools such as calendar, calculator, currency converter, notepad, alarm clock, world clock and stop watch.

The phone will be made available to users on April 22 at Verizon Wireless Communications Stores as well as online at verizonwireless.com. Samsung Reality comes with a price tag of $79.99 following a $50 mail-in rebate in the form of a debit card, upon receipt. The card may later be used as a normal debit card. In order to gain maximum from Reality, users need to subscribe to a Nationwide Talk or Nationwide Talk & Text plan. With this they would also need to make a purchase of data package beginning at $9.99 per month for 25MB with Mobile Email.
